The sample is a PDF document identified as malicious by ClamAV and exhibits critical heuristic firings for CVE-2010-0188, an XFA form exploit in Adobe Reader. The embedded XFA content, though obfuscated, likely contains the exploit code. The presence of an embedded URL, while not directly malicious in reputation, is typical for exploit delivery mechanisms.

  • Adobe Reader LibTIFF XFA image exploit — CVE-2010-0188 critical CVE likely CVE_2010_0188
    PDF contains the CVE-2010-0188 exploit template: XFA JavaScript heap-spray setup, a generated TIFF image payload, and assignment of that TIFF data to an XFA image field rawValue to trigger Adobe Reader's LibTIFF parser.
